Re: [PATCH 1/2] net: Remove net/ipx.h and uapi/linux/ipx.h header files

From: Eugene Syromiatnikov <hidden>
Date: 2021-09-01 16:52:26

Adding linux-audit, strace-devel, and linux-api to CC:.

On Wed, Sep 01, 2021 at 06:02:44PM +0200, Eugene Syromiatnikov wrote:
On Fri, Aug 13, 2021 at 08:08:02PM +0800, Cai Huoqing wrote:
quoted
commit <47595e32869f> ("<MAINTAINERS: Mark some staging directories>")
indicated the ipx network layer as obsolete in Jan 2018,
updated in the MAINTAINERS file

now, after being exposed for 3 years to refactoring, so to
delete uapi/linux/ipx.h and net/ipx.h header files for good.
additionally, there is no module that depends on ipx.h except
a broken staging driver(r8188eu)

Signed-off-by: Cai Huoqing <redacted>
This removal breaks audit[1] and potentially breaks strace[2][3], at least.

Unfortunately, that is not how UAPI works.  That change breaks building
of the existing code;  one cannot change already released versions
of either audit, strace, or any other userspace program that happens
to unconditionally include <linux/ipx.h> without any fallback (like
<netipx/ipx.h> provided by glibc).

Unfortunately, that is not how UAPI works.  That change breaks 
building
of the existing code;  one cannot change already released versions
of either audit, strace, or any other userspace program that happens
to unconditionally include <linux/ipx.h> without any fallback (like
<netipx/ipx.h> provided by glibc).
Also, the <netipx/ipx.h> fallback is only provided by glibc (and maybe 
uclibc?). With this patch, it is now impossible to compile even the 
very latest version of "strace" with a musl toolchain.
